Key technical/timing indicators and potential downside path

“Three red weeks” weekly pattern

  • The channel’s framework: watch for three consecutive red weeks.
  • Typical follow-through they expect:
    1. a bounce
    2. then a retest of the low associated with the “three red weeks” signal
  • They claim the pattern has occurred and suggest support around ~$60k may be forming (with examples of 60k support cited).

200-week moving average (bear-market confirmation)

  • The 200-week MA is cited at ~$62,500.
  • If there is a weekly close below the 200-week MA, they expect price to move toward the 300-week MA.
  • Target cited:
    • ~$54,500 (about ~10% below the current context), aligned with the 300-week MA.

GAN retracement / conservative downside zone

  • A conservative retracement band is mentioned between 0.25 and 0.382.
  • Approximate price range discussed:
    • $43,000 to $58,000
  • Implication:
    • Bitcoin is described as approaching conservative downside targets, with still no market-turn confirmation.

Macro conditions (rates, USD, equities)

Fed meeting probability (July)

  • July meeting probabilities (as described):
    • 65% pause/hold
    • 34% chance of increase
  • The speaker says probabilities have shifted toward hikes, implying tighter financial conditions / less liquidity.

Liquidity “curveball” scenario

  • If the market expects hikes but they don’t happen, money could rush back into markets (especially risk assets).

S&P 500 / Nasdaq setup

  • The S&P 500 is described as stalled, with:
    • a sideways grind or
    • another correction into Q3
  • A “signal back in May” is mentioned (noted around the 19th), followed by sideways action.

18-year cycle framework (equity risk window)

  • Expected risk-asset weakness is tied to an “18-year cycle.”
  • Potential hit period cited:
    • ~2027–2029/2030
  • Bounces may occur, but the speaker expects they likely have smaller % moves than crypto historically.

Equity cycle timing (composite decade cycles)

  • Expect late September / early October lows on the S&P 500 composite indicator.
  • Similarity cited to 2022:
    • a midterm year where the market repeatedly fell/rebounded before the bear market ended.
  • Caution: recession calls may not always materialize (history referenced as 2016/2017-type).
